Factors to Consider When Choosing Best Camera Bags

Choosing the best camera bag requires understanding your specific needs and how different features impact usability. Beyond basic protection, consider factors like organization, comfort during transport, and compatibility with your gear. A well-chosen bag can enhance your workflow and extend the lifespan of your equipment, so weighing these broader considerations helps make a smarter purchase.

Protection and Weather Resistance

Effective protection against bumps, scratches, and weather is crucial, especially if you shoot outdoors. Waterproof or water-resistant fabrics help keep your gear dry during unexpected rain, but they often add weight and cost. Consider how often you’ll be exposed to harsh conditions and select a bag that offers sufficient coverage for your typical environment. Remember, a lighter bag with minimal weather resistance may be fine for urban use, while outdoor photography demands more rugged protection.

Capacity and Organization

Assess the amount of gear you typically carry—camera bodies, lenses, accessories, and a laptop. Look for bags with customizable compartments, padded dividers, and dedicated pockets to prevent gear from shifting and getting damaged. Overpacking can weigh you down, so choose a size that matches your usual kit. A bag with smart organization features saves time during shoots and makes accessing gear on the go much easier.

Comfort and Carrying Style

Comfort matters more than many realize, especially if you carry gear for extended periods. Padded straps, ergonomic back panels, and adjustable harnesses improve comfort and reduce fatigue. Consider whether a backpack, sling, or shoulder bag suits your shooting style; backpacks distribute weight evenly, while slings offer quick access and mobility. Think about your typical shooting scenarios to pick the most comfortable and practical design.

Size and Compatibility

Size matters not just for fit but also for convenience. Check the bag’s internal dimensions against your camera and lens sizes to avoid a tight squeeze or excessive bulk. Compatibility with accessories like tripods or drones can be a deciding factor, especially for outdoor or travel photographers. A bag that fits your gear comfortably without excess space reduces bulk and makes transport more manageable.

Price and Value

Higher price often correlates with premium materials, advanced weatherproofing, and additional features, but there are many affordable options that deliver excellent value. Consider your budget against your gear protection needs and how often you’ll use the bag. Investing in a durable, well-padded bag pays off over time, but for casual or occasional use, a more budget-friendly model might suffice. Balance features with cost to find the best overall value for your specific situation.

Frequently Asked Questions

Should I choose a backpack or a sling bag for my camera gear?

The choice depends on how you prefer to carry your gear and your shooting style. Backpacks distribute weight evenly, making them ideal for longer outings and heavier gear, while sling bags offer quick access and are better for short, casual shoots. If you often move between locations or need to access gear swiftly, a sling could be more practical. Conversely, for all-day outdoor photography, a well-padded backpack provides better comfort and protection.

Is waterproofing essential in a camera bag?

Waterproofing can be a significant benefit if you shoot outdoors frequently or in unpredictable weather. It helps protect your gear from rain, snow, or accidental water exposure, extending the lifespan of your equipment. However, waterproof bags tend to be heavier and more expensive. If your photography is mostly urban or indoor, water resistance may suffice, but for outdoor adventures, investing in a truly waterproof design is wise.

How much space do I need in a camera bag?

The ideal space depends on your gear collection. A basic kit with one camera body and two lenses requires less room, while professionals with multiple bodies, lenses, drones, and accessories need larger capacity. Overestimating can lead to unnecessary bulk, but underestimating might leave you without enough space during shoots. Measure your gear and consider future needs before choosing a size to avoid compromises later.

Are hard-shell camera bags better than soft-sided ones?

Hard-shell bags offer excellent protection against impacts and are ideal for transporting fragile gear over long distances or through rough conditions. Soft-sided bags tend to be lighter and more flexible, allowing easier access and storage in tight spaces. The right choice depends on how fragile your gear is and your typical travel conditions. For rugged outdoor use, a hard shell provides peace of mind, while urban shooters may prefer the convenience of soft-sided designs.

Is it worth paying more for a professional-grade camera bag?

Investing in a premium camera bag often delivers better durability, weather resistance, and organizational options, making it worthwhile for serious photographers or those who travel frequently. Higher-end bags also tend to offer enhanced comfort features and longer-lasting materials. However, for hobbyists or occasional shooters, a mid-range or budget option may provide sufficient protection and functionality without the extra cost. Consider your shooting frequency and gear value when deciding whether to splurge.
